This a great driving 1961 Chevrolet Corvette convertible with a factory hardtop and factory convertible soft top. California blue plate car. It is ready to jump in and enjoy today. It has a 283 c.i. small block Chevy that runs very well. It is not the original block, but I do have another bare block that came with the car that I believe is the right date code for the car. It has been decked so there are no numbers on the pad. The previous owner thought it might be the original one to the car, but I am not sure. Four speed manual transmission that shifts smoothly. It starts right up, settles into a nice smooth idle, and sounds like a Corvette should. It has a brand new stainless exhaust system. The brakes have been recently re-done. Wide White Wall tires that are only about a year old and have good tread. Factory Corvette hubcaps. The body is in good condition. The paint is old and should be re-done if you want a show car, but I actually like it better this way because you can drive it and have fun everyday without worrying about it every second. It has chips and scratches in the paint. The frame is excellent. It has not been undercoated and is extremely solid. The chrome shines okay, but has some scratches. The interior is very nice. The seats are excellent. The carpet is good and is black, but I also have a brand new still in the box red Auto Custom Carpet kit. Original shifter, steering wheel, and Wonderbar radio. The windshield wipers work fine. The tach does not work. All the lights and signals work well. The door panels have been re-done incorrectly. The dashpad is decent. It is not cracked, but is a little dry. All in all, this is a great driving solid axle Corvette that will make a great car for someone. I have a bunch of pictures that I can e-mail to serious buyers.
